I had a 30 minute phone screen with the HR person. She was very friendly. Next, I had a 30 minute phone interview with the hiring manager. The hiring manager was very pressed for time. She came across as very stressed, with very little interest in answering questions I had. I asked "how long does it take a developer to deliver a single line of code to production". I ask this question to learn about CI/CD pipeline health. She was confused by the question and seemingly irritated by it, then preceded to begrudgingly answered it. That was the end of the interview. The conversation with the hiring manager was a red flag for me. If she didn't have the time or patience to talk to me during an interview, that wasn't a good sign.
